Wire Mesh Uses: From Construction to Agriculture

Wire mesh is a versatile material with a wide range of applications across various industries. In construction, it's employed for reinforcing concrete structures, creating safe fencing and barriers, and providing support for scaffolding and formwork. Agriculture utilizes wire mesh for erecting animal enclosures, holding livestock, and protecting crops from pests and damage.

Furthermore, wire mesh finds applications in filtration systems, industrial manufacturing, and even decorative projects. Its durability, flexibility, and affordability make it a popular choice for both small-scale and large-scale endeavors.
